Abstract
A large number of adrenal tumors are now identified either incidentally or associated with a metastatic workup for cancer. While the vast majority of these lesions are benign, those that prove to be primary or secondary cancers are traditionally treated with surgical resection. A wide variety of alternative, less invasive therapies exist. One of these, thermal ablation, is examined herein. J. Surg. Oncol. 2012; 106:626–631. © 2012 Wiley Periodicals, Inc.
